CARL P. DiLELLA, D.O

Specializing in Sports Medicine, General Orthopedics, and Joint Replacement

During his sports medicine fellowship at the prestigious Los Angeles Orthopedic Institute, Dr. Carl DiLella performed more than 500 orthopedic surgeries alongside nationally renowned orthopedic surgeons. His fellowship also provided him with specialty training in advanced shoulder and knee arthroscopy, maximizing his skill in arthroscopic rotator cuff repair and labral repair, as well as arthroscopic ACL (anterior cruciate ligament) and PCL (posterior cruciate ligament) reconstruction.

In 2006, Dr. DiLella was accepted into the AO Trauma Fellowship program sponsored by Synthes. The program allows orthopedic surgeons from the United States to study in trauma centers throughout Europe. Dr. DiLella completed his AO Trauma Fellowship at the Spital Davos in Davos, Switzerland, where he was exposed to the most current techniques in orthopedic trauma and fracture care.
